Perdition: Mail Retrieval Proxy

  What is perdition?

   Perdition is allows users to connect to a content-free POP3 or IMAP4
   server that will redirect them to their real POP3 or IMAP4 server.
   This enables mail retrieval for a domain to be split across multiple
   backend servers on a per user basis. This can also be used to as a
   POP3 or IMAP4 proxy especially in firewall applications. Perdition
   supports arbitrary library based map access to determine the server
   for a user. POSIX Regular Expression, GDBM, MySQL and PostgreSQL
   libraries ship with the distribution. The use of perditon to scale
   mail services beyond a single box is discussed in a paper I wrote on
   high capacity email.

TECHNICAL DETAILS
*****************

Once again, GOBBLES uses he great cut'n'paste skills to paste the following
piece of information from libvanessa_logger/vanessa_logger.c !!

  /**********************************************************************
   * __vanessa_logger_log
   * Internal function to log a message
   * pre: vl: logger to use
   *      priority: priority to log with
   *                Only used if log type is __vanessa_logger_syslog
   *                Ignored otherwise
   *      fmt: format for log message
   *      ap: varargs for format
   * post: message is logged to appropriate logger
   *       vl->ident[pid]: will be prepended to each log
   *       '\n' will be appended to each log that doesn't already end with
   *       a '\n'
   *       Nothing on error
   * return: none
   **********************************************************************/
  
  #define __VANESSA_LOGGER_DO_FH(_vl, _fmt, _fh, _ap) \
      { \
      int len; \
      if(snprintf( \
        _vl->buffer, \
        _vl->buffer_len-1, \
          "%s[%d]: %s",  \
        _vl->ident,  \
        getpid(),  \
        _fmt \
      )<0){ \
        fprintf(_fh, "__vanessa_logger_log: snprintf: output truncated\n"); \
        return; \
        } \
      len=strlen(_vl->buffer); \
      if(*((_vl->buffer)+len-1)!='\n'){ \
        *((_vl->buffer)+len)='\n'; \
        *((_vl->buffer)+len+1)='\0'; \
        } \
      vfprintf(_fh, _vl->buffer, _ap); \
    }
  
   static void __vanessa_logger_log(
    __vanessa_logger_t *vl, 
    int priority, 
    char *fmt, 
    va_list ap
  ){
    if(vl==NULL||vl->ready==__vanessa_logger_false||priority>vl->max_priority){
      return;
    }
  
    switch(vl->type){
      case __vanessa_logger_filehandle:
        __VANESSA_LOGGER_DO_FH(vl, fmt, vl->data.d_filehandle, ap);
        break;
      case __vanessa_logger_filename:
        __VANESSA_LOGGER_DO_FH(vl, fmt, vl->data.d_filename->filehandle, ap);
          break;
      case __vanessa_logger_syslog:
        if(vsnprintf(vl->buffer, vl->buffer_len, fmt, ap)<0){
            syslog(priority, "__vanessa_logger_log: vsnprintf: output truncated");
          return;
          }
        syslog(priority, vl->buffer);
        break;
        case __vanessa_logger_none:
        break;
    }
  }
  

Sharp reader see bad syslog() usage behavior (like hitting heself with hammer
while being drunk, hehehe).

      syslog(priority, vl->buffer);


WORKAROUND
**********

GOBBLES suggest concerned admin uninstall perdition and install 
more secure pop3 daemon instead, like maybe Microsoft product.

As a temporary fix GOBBLES modified libvanessa_logger.c:

-      syslog(priority, vl->buffer);
+      syslog(priority, "%s", vl->buffer);
